= K8S sur cloud ou bare metal ? =

J'en ai exécuté un sur du métal nu la semaine dernière et je n'y vois aucun avantage. Nous le faisons à des fins d'enquête interne. Exécutez-vous le vôtre en métal nu ? Pourquoi?
Je suis d'accord, cela dépend de votre objectif et des ressources dont vous disposez, des serveurs, de l'argent, du temps, etc.

En fait, j'exécute mon K8S sur des machines virtuelles dans un VMWare VCenter sur site. J'avais déjà les ressources et je l'utilise surtout pour tester avec des k8. J'ai commencé à courir sur VMware au départ juste pour apprendre les k8, mais je suis allé l'utiliser à des fins de test

Je l'ai fait pour deux de mes clients. Ils voulaient devenir natifs du cloud mais en même temps, la loi exige de conserver les données dans mon pays (secteur public)

Un installé avec kubeadm et l'autre avec rke

Le kubeadm offrait un contrôle total, mais les opérateurs de mélange et d'appariement pouvaient être un cauchemar en raison des versions. Rancher de l'autre côté propose un ensemble de cartes de barre organisées qui fonctionnent très bien

S'il s'agit d'un usage personnel, cela peut ne pas s'appliquer, mais pour les déploiements en entreprise, il existe des nuances de gestion. Les hyperscalers sont une offre entièrement gérée, mais vous pouvez avoir un système bare metal géré afin que vous ne vous souciez pas du rack, du câblage, des correctifs du micrologiciel, etc. Ou vous pourriez avoir un plan de contrôle géré sur du métal nu, peut-être même dans votre colo. cela coûte parfois plus cher qu'un hyperscaler même, mais a l'avantage de vous permettre d'avoir une offre managée performante et proche de vos autres données

IME le gros hic pour le cloud vient du déplacement des données. L'automatisation est géniale, mais si vos données ne sont pas déjà là ou si des données vont y rester, la facture sera incroyablement

Les avantages sont le contrôle du matériel, les données sur site et les coûts. Mais vous devez disposer d'un processus de déploiement solide dans lequel vous pouvez facilement recycler un nœud. Cela aide beaucoup dans les scénarios de dépannage avec des logiciels complexes d'appuyer simplement sur le bouton de réinitialisation. C'est l'un des avantages si vous continuez à penser IaC

Nous gérons environ 30+ clusters à l'échelle mondiale, y compris le réseau sous-jacent. J'apprécie vraiment la technologie derrière. C'est dur mais je ne le changerais pas pour une plate-forme hébergée juste à cause de la joie que cela m'apporte personnellement

D'un point de vue, je pense que si vous n'avez pas besoin de matériel spécial ou d'une tonne de matériel de stockage, les solutions hébergées pourraient être moins chères. Surtout en ce qui concerne le salaire de l'équipe / le nombre de personnes puisque le gros du travail est couvert

== À propos de la communauté ==
Kubernauts
En ligne